The Future of Delivery: Deutsche Post DHL’s Bold Leap into Autonomous Trucks

Sep 8, 2024 | Trends

In the ever-evolving landscape of logistics and delivery, Deutsche Post DHL (DPDHL) has set its sights on an ambitious mission: the rollout of self-driving delivery trucks by 2018. This game-changing initiative comes in collaboration with ZF, an industry leader in auto supply, and harnesses cutting-edge technology from Nvidia. Charting a New Course with Autonomous Delivery Vehicles

DPDHL is not merely dabbling in the realm of self-driving vehicles; it’s committing to a comprehensive transformation of its logistics. With a fleet of 3,400 electric StreetScooter vehicles, the company is strategically equipping these trucks with advanced technology that includes ZF sensors, video cameras, LiDAR, and radar. This substantial groundwork is pivotal for a seamless transition to autonomy.

The Role of AI in Delivery

Central to this initiative is the use of ZF’s Nvidia-based ProAI self-driving system. This sophisticated AI relies on the data collected from DPDHL’s electric vehicles to train its algorithms. Through continual learning from real-world delivery scenarios, ProAI aims to adeptly navigate complex urban environments. This not only paves the way for efficient deliveries but also enhances safety and reliability, addressing key challenges faced in logistics.

Innovative Technology Behind the Venture

The technological backbone of this initiative is impressive. DPDHL employs Nvidia’s DGX-1 AI supercomputer in its data centers, which allows for the training of neural networks integral to the operation of autonomous vehicles. By leveraging powerful computing capabilities, DPDHL is poised to create a fleet that not only understands its immediate surroundings but also predicts and reacts to various scenarios in real time.

Prototype Reveal: A Glimpse into the Future

During the GTC Europe conference, attendees witnessed the unveiling of a prototype electric delivery vehicle outfitted with state-of-the-art technology. With an array of six cameras, two LiDAR sensors, and a radar system, this truck represents a significant milestone in the journey towards automated deliveries. The multi-faceted sensor setup enhances the vehicle’s awareness, enabling it to make split-second decisions that are crucial in dynamic urban settings.

The broader Impact on the Delivery Ecosystem

The deployment of self-driving delivery trucks is not just a technological leap; it has far-reaching consequences for the logistics industry. Here are some noteworthy points to consider:

  • Increased Efficiency: Automated vehicles have the potential to optimize delivery routes, reduce fuel consumption, and minimize human error, leading to faster delivery times.
  • Environmental Benefits: By utilizing electric vehicles, DPDHL supports a greener approach to logistics, aligning with global sustainability goals.
  • Workforce Transformation: While automation may reduce the need for certain roles, it also opens new avenues for skilled jobs in AI development, maintenance, and oversight.
